The Process of Obtaining a European Driving License in Poland
Getting a European driving license in Poland normally requires the following actions:

Eligibility Assessment
Validate that the applicant fulfills the age requirements:Minimum age for category B: 18 yearsMinimum age for classification A (motorbikes): 24 years, or 20 with two years of experience on category A1.
Medical Examination
Undergo a medical exam to guarantee that the person is fit to drive. This exam normally consists of vision and physical tests.
Driving School Enrollment
Enlist in a certified driving school. Training consists of:Theoretical classes (discovering the rules of the road)Practical driving lessons
Passing the Exams
Pass the theoretical exam and useful driving test. The passing rates can differ, making preparation important.
Sending the Application
Send the needed documentation to the local authority (Urząd komunikacji), that includes:Completed application typeMedical checkup accreditationProof of identity and residencyConfirmation of passing the testsAppropriate fees
License Issuance
Upon approval, the license will be issued.
